THIS COURSE AIMS TO PROVIDE A MODERN INTRODUCTION BOTH TO THE THEORY AND TECHNOLGIES THAT ARE BEHIND COMPUTING AND DIGITAL PUBLISHING.
STUDENTS WILL BE ABLE:
- TO GET A BASIC KNOWLEDGE, WITH CRITICAL CONSCIOUSNESS, OF TECHNOLOGY AND METHODS OF BOTH COMPUTER SCIENCE AND INFORMATION THEORY IN ORDER TO BE ABLE TO USE PROGRAMMING LANGUAGES AND TOOLS FOR DIGITAL PUBLISHING;
- TO MONITOR FURTHER DEVELOPMENTS OF COMPUTER AND INFORMATION SCIENCE APPLIED TO DIGITAL PUBLISHING;
- TO DEVELOP ELEMENTARY PROJECTS AND SIMPLE AUTOMATIC TASKS DEDICATED TO DIGITAL PUBLISHING.
STUDENTS WILL BE ABLE:
- TO GET A BASIC KNOWLEDGE, WITH CRITICAL CONSCIOUSNESS, OF TECHNOLOGY AND METHODS OF BOTH COMPUTER SCIENCE AND INFORMATION THEORY IN ORDER TO BE ABLE TO USE PROGRAMMING LANGUAGES AND TOOLS FOR DIGITAL PUBLISHING;
- TO MONITOR FURTHER DEVELOPMENTS OF COMPUTER AND INFORMATION SCIENCE APPLIED TO DIGITAL PUBLISHING;
- TO DEVELOP ELEMENTARY PROJECTS AND SIMPLE AUTOMATIC TASKS DEDICATED TO DIGITAL PUBLISHING.
teacher profile teaching materials
Introduction to programming languages, in particular the Python language
Mutuazione: 20710378 INTRODUZIONE ALL'INFORMATICA in Scienze della Comunicazione L-20 MAIELI ROBERTO
Programme
Information theory and coding, elaboration and structuring.Introduction to programming languages, in particular the Python language
Core Documentation
slides and handouts available on the course webpage https://sites.google.com/view/intro-info-rm3/homeType of delivery of the course
This course includes: Face-to-face lectures; Discussions with students and debates on the discussed topics; Exercices; Attendance is not mandatory but strongly recommended.Type of evaluation
Written and/or oral exam, of a duration usually between 60 and 80 minutes or, only for those attending the course, the development of a project